"Sherman?" Anthea was momentarily taken aback, not expecting him to call her out of the blue.

"Yes," Sherman continued, "I've just arrived in Pellonia."

"Alright," Anthea replied. "I've heard Pellonia has been a bit chaotic lately. Make sure to stay safe and don't go out after dark."

Was she actually concerned about him?

Sherman couldn't help but smile slightly. "I will."

After chatting a bit more, Anthea ended the call.

Sherman looked up at the rising sun, its warm glow reflecting in his eyes. After a brief pause, he turned to his secretary. "Let's go."

The secretary promptly followed in his footsteps.

Meanwhile, Anthea had just hung up when another call came through. It was from Nanson, who she assumed must have been on the same flight as Sherman.

Three days passed in the blink of an eye.

On this particular day, Anthea was in her front yard, watering the flowers in her little garden.

Suddenly, she heard someone calling her name from outside.

She glanced up and saw Alex, dressed in a suit, his expression serious.

"Alex?"

Alex nodded briefly, keeping it short. "Anthea, my grandmother's not doing well. Could you come with me to see her?"

"Of course." Anthea put down the watering can, hopped over the garden fence with a fluid, graceful movement.

Alex was momentarily stunned. "Aren't you going to lock the balcony door?"

"No need," Anthea replied lightly. "I have a security robot at home. Where’s your car? We should hurry."

"Follow me," Alex said, and Anthea quickly matched his pace.

Once in the car, Alex habitually unwrapped a butterscotch candy, popped it in his mouth, and handed another to Anthea.
